Measurements
- Every pixel on the panorama has it’s XYZ representation in project coordinate system
- User can measure distances, angles and areas
- Each point is checked for reliability of the point cloud to avoid false measurements in poorly defined areas (like edges)
- Measurement can be saved to CSV file for future use

Linked files
- OrbiView allows to attach external files such as photos, scans, or documents to each object.
-
System supports two kinds of files:
- Project library files - files that are common to many objects, like operating instructions or product cards. Such files are stored once and linked to relevant objects. This avoids data redundancy and simplifies updates.
- Object-specific files - files that are unique to a specific object, such as a technical inspection report for a particular device.
